A businessman involved in oil and silver investment, played a significant role in the silver market during the late 1970s and early 1980s. Attempted to corner the silver market along with his brother, which led to dramatic price increases and subsequent market crash. This event resulted in substantial financial losses for many investors and contributed to regulatory changes in commodity trading.

A prominent American bass player and bandleader, notable for contributions to the development of rock and roll music in the 1950s. Rose to fame as a member of Elvis Presley's original band, providing the iconic bass lines essential to the rockabilly sound. After leaving Presley's group, formed Bill Black's Combo, which achieved success on the charts with instrumental hits. The combo blended elements of rock, country, and rhythm and blues, and garnered popularity in the late 1950s and early 1960s.
